Calysta is a biotechnology company based in San Mateo, California that produces sustainable protein ingredients using a patented fermentation platform. The company's flagship product, FeedKind, is a single-cell protein made by fermenting methane using microorganisms, without requiring any plant or animal inputs. This process uses minimal water and land compared to conventional protein production. FeedKind is primarily targeted for use in aquaculture, pet food, and livestock feed applications. In 2022, Calysta and its joint venture partner Adisseo opened a 20,000-tonne capacity commercial production facility in Chongqing, China through their Calysseo partnership. This marked the world's first industrial-scale plant producing proteins that do not rely on plant or animal ingredients. Calysta has also developed a human food ingredient called Positive Protein, which is described as highly nutritious and comparable to high-quality animal proteins.

The company's fermentation technology allows for year-round production without using arable land. FeedKind has been validated through trials for use in feeds for various aquaculture species including seabass, bream, salmon, and shrimp. In February 2023, FeedKind received US FDA approval for use in salmonid feeds at up to 18% inclusion. Calysta positions its products as helping to meet growing global protein demand more sustainably while preserving biodiversity. The company aims to expand production capacity significantly, with plans announced in 2022 to build a 100,000-tonne facility in Saudi Arabia through the Calysseo joint venture.

Key customers and partnerships

Calysta has formed strategic partnerships to commercialize and scale up production of its protein ingredients. Its key joint venture is Calysseo, formed with global animal nutrition company Adisseo. Through this partnership, Calysta opened its first commercial-scale FeedKind facility in China in 2022, targeting the Asian aquaculture market. Calysseo is also planning a much larger facility in Saudi Arabia. Calysta's products are aimed at aquaculture companies, as well as pet food and livestock feed producers. The company has received regulatory approvals for use of FeedKind in animal feeds in markets including the US, EU, and UK. Calysta has also partnered with Food Caravan, a business development company, to support its planned expansion into Saudi Arabia.
